# Finance Manager

A comprehensive toolkit for personal finance management that processes transaction data, performs sophisticated financial analysis, generates actionable insights, and creates beautiful visual reports.

## Core Capabilities

1. **Transaction Data Processing**: Extract financial data from PDFs, CSVs, or JSON files
2. **Financial Analysis**: Calculate key metrics, identify spending patterns, and track savings
3. **Visualization**: Generate interactive HTML reports with charts and graphs
4. **Budget Recommendations**: Provide personalized, actionable advice based on spending patterns
5. **Trend Analysis**: Identify spending patterns, anomalies, and opportunities for optimization

## Workflow

### 1. Data Extraction and Preparation

**For PDF files:**
```bash
python scripts/extract_pdf_data.py <input.pdf> <output.csv>
```

**For CSV/JSON files:**
- Ensure data has columns: `Date`, `Description`, `Income` (category), `Type`, `Amount`
- Date format: YYYY-MM-DD or parseable date string
- Amount: Positive for income, negative for expenses

### 2. Financial Analysis

Run comprehensive analysis on transaction data:
```bash
python scripts/analyze_finances.py <transactions.csv> > analysis_output.json
```

**Output includes:**
- Summary statistics (total income, expenses, net savings, savings rate)
- Spending trends (daily averages, top expenses, category percentages)
- Budget recommendations (personalized based on spending patterns)
- Visualization data (prepared for charting)

### 3. Report Generation

Create interactive HTML report with visualizations:
```bash
python scripts/generate_report.py <analysis_output.json> <report.html>
```

**Report features:**
- Summary dashboard with key metrics
- Interactive pie chart showing spending by category
- Bar chart comparing income vs expenses over time
- Color-coded indicators (green for positive, red for negative)
- Personalized recommendations section
- Responsive design for all devices

### 4. Complete Workflow Example

```bash
# Extract data from PDF
python scripts/extract_pdf_data.py finance_data.pdf transactions.csv

# Analyze the data
python scripts/analyze_finances.py transactions.csv > analysis.json

# Generate visual report
python scripts/generate_report.py analysis.json financial_report.html
```

## Key Metrics and Benchmarks

### Savings Rate
```
Savings Rate = (Total Income - Total Expenses) / Total Income × 100
```

**Benchmarks:**
- Below 10%: Needs improvement
- 10-20%: Good
- 20-30%: Excellent  
- Above 30%: Outstanding

### Category Guidelines (% of income)
- Housing: 25-30%
- Transportation: 10-15%
- Food: 10-15%
- Utilities: 5-10%
- Savings: Minimum 20%

For detailed frameworks and methodologies, see `references/financial_frameworks.md`.

## Tips for Best Results

### Data Quality
- Ensure all transactions are properly categorized
- Use consistent category names
- Include complete date information
- Verify amounts are correctly signed (+ for income, - for expenses)

### Analysis Frequency
- Run monthly analysis for trend tracking
- Generate reports at month-end for review
- Compare month-over-month to identify changes

### Action on Recommendations
- Prioritize recommendations by potential impact
- Set specific, measurable goals based on insights
- Track progress by re-running analysis regularly

## Dependencies

All scripts require Python 3.7+ with standard libraries. Additional requirements:

**For PDF extraction:**
```bash
pip install pdfplumber --break-system-packages
```

**For data analysis:**
```bash
pip install pandas --break-system-packages
```

All visualization dependencies are loaded from CDN in the HTML output (Chart.js).

## File Organization

```
finance-manager/
├── scripts/
│   ├── extract_pdf_data.py     # PDF → CSV conversion
│   ├── analyze_finances.py     # Financial analysis engine
│   └── generate_report.py      # HTML report generator
└── references/
    └── financial_frameworks.md # Detailed analysis methodologies
```

## Customization

### Adding Custom Categories
Edit the category definitions in `analyze_finances.py` to match your tracking system.

### Adjusting Thresholds
Modify recommendation thresholds in the `generate_budget_recommendations()` function to match personal goals.

### Styling Reports
Customize the HTML_TEMPLATE in `generate_report.py` to adjust colors, fonts, or layout.
